Abstract
The hospital charts of 274 infants under 6 months of age with culture-proved respiratory syncytial virus infections were reviewed. Fifty-six infants (20.4%) demonstrated apnea in association with RSV infection. Predisposing factors significantly correlated with apnea included premature birth and young chronologic age at the time of virus infection.
